my Bastard sword is +10, but i want to add lightning.. is my weapon getting stronger or weaker? Also im a quality build.

it'll reduce the stat scaling. Since slabs and bastard swords aren't that hard to come by in this game, if you want a lightning weapon for enemies it's good against, make a second one.
 
Thanks, will do. im still confused bout scaling, and how it works.

quality build (str and dex) works best with upgraded but not infused weapons.
infused weapons scale off of other stats as much or more than they do off of str and dex.
stuff that scales at S or A scales off stats much more than stuff at D or E.
